Zekelman Industries is a renowned family of companies proudly recognized as the largest independent steel pipe and tube manufacturer in North America. With a legacy dating back to 1877, Zekelman Industries has built a solid reputation as a 100% domestic manufacturer known for quality and innovation. The organization plays a fundamental role in shaping the infrastructure of where people live, work, and play, supplying essential steel products to hospitals, hotels, schools, bridges, airports, and more. Job Requirements
- must have transportation to work
- high school graduate or equivalent preferred
- able to work in all elements depending on job location, time of year, heat, cold, rain, snow
- must always have the required tools with them
- work from all type ladders including step ladders up to 14', 'A' frame ladders, and all size extension ladders and relocate up to 12' step ladder by oneself
- perform work at various heights and up to 90 ft from ladders, scaffolds, aerial lifts, catwalks, or other safe work areas
- work in restricted areas such as switchgear room, manholes, utility tunnels, crawl spaces, attics
- always wear personal protective equipment including hard hats and safety glasses and a respirator when required
- repetitive use of arms, hands, and fingers
- able to work 8 hours per day, 40 hours per week, overtime as required, and night shifts
- willing to apply for and maintain a State of Texas Electrical Apprentice License

Job Duties
- assist electricians by performing tasks under the direct supervision of an electrician actually installing the work and handling the bulk of the materials
- keep all materials, tools, and equipment in an orderly fashion and keep the work area clean at all times
- demonstrate safe work habits and proper care of tools and equipment
- conduit bending
- installing electrical equipment such as switchgear, panels, and starters
- pulling and terminating wire
- installing light fixtures
- installation of lighting controls
- installation of all types of devices
- troubleshoot many electrical systems
- read and comprehend safety rules and policies and MSDS sheets
